The Conversion Factor: The Bridge Between Pounds and Kilograms

The key to converting pounds to kilograms lies in the conversion factor. One pound is approximately equal to 0.453592 kilograms. This factor is the constant that allows us to translate measurements from one system to the other. Remember, this is an approximation; a more precise conversion might use more decimal places, but for most practical purposes, this level of precision is sufficient.

Method 1: Direct Multiplication

The most straightforward method for converting 352 lb to kg is through direct multiplication using the conversion factor:

352 lb * 0.453592 kg/lb ≈ 159.58 kg

This simple calculation gives us the approximate equivalent of 352 pounds in kilograms. Think about it: we multiply the weight in pounds by the conversion factor to obtain the weight in kilograms. The result, approximately 159.58 kg, provides a precise conversion suitable for most applications.

Beyond the Calculation: Practical Applications

Converting weights from pounds to kilograms has various practical applications across numerous fields:

  • International Trade: Global trade often requires specifying weights in kilograms, adhering to SI standards. Converting pounds to kilograms ensures accurate communication and avoids misunderstandings.

  • Scientific Research: In scientific experiments and research, consistency in units is critical. Converting to kilograms facilitates data analysis and comparison across studies.

  • Healthcare: Many healthcare professionals use the metric system, requiring conversion for accurate medication dosages or patient weight monitoring.

  • Engineering and Manufacturing: Design specifications and manufacturing processes frequently use kilograms for weight measurements. Converting ensures proper material selection and structural integrity.

  • Shipping and Logistics: International shipping companies rely on kilograms to calculate freight costs and handle weight restrictions.

  • Cooking and Baking: While some recipes might use pounds, converting to kilograms is helpful for consistency and accuracy, particularly when using metric measuring tools.

  • Fitness and Nutrition: Tracking weight changes, understanding nutritional information, and comparing fitness goals often requires converting between pounds and kilograms.
